Associations to the word «Kaftan»

Wiktionary

KAFTAN, noun. A long tunic worn in the Eastern Mediterranean.
KAFTAN, noun. A long dress or shirt similar in style to those worn in the Eastern Mediterranean.

Dictionary definition

KAFTAN, noun. A woman's dress style that imitates the caftan cloaks worn by men in the Near East.
KAFTAN, noun. A (cotton or silk) cloak with full sleeves and sash reaching down to the ankles; worn by men in the Levant.
